  1. Click ‘Get Form’ to open the DD Form 149 in the editor.
  2. Begin by filling out Section 1, 'Applicant Data.' Here, indicate your branch of service and provide your full name, present or last pay grade, service number, and Social Security Number (SSN).
  3. In Section 2, specify your current status with respect to the armed services. Choose from options like Active Duty, Reserve, or Retired.
  4. For Section 5, clearly state the error or injustice you wish to correct. Be specific about what needs changing.
  5. In Section 6, provide reasons why you believe the record is erroneous. This may include supporting evidence or documentation.
  6. Complete Sections 8 through 12 as applicable. Ensure all required fields are filled out accurately before submitting.

Applications should include all available evidence, such as signed statements of witnesses or a brief of arguments supporting the requested correction. Application is made with DD Form 149, available at VA offices, from veterans organizations or from (DoD Forms Management Program ) webpage.
PRINCIPAL PURPOSE(S): To initiate an application for correction of military record. The form is used by Board members for review of pertinent information in making a determination of relief through correction of a military record.
